Crossing Hurdles is seeking a DevOps Engineer to design, implement, and maintain CI/CD pipelines. The role involves managing containerized applications using Docker and Kubernetes while collaborating with developers to enhance infrastructure reliability and scalability.
Responsibilities:
- Design, implement, and maintain CI/CD pipelines using tools such as Jenkins, GitHub Actions, and Terraform
- Build, deploy, and manage containerized applications using Docker and Kubernetes in cloud environments
- Collaborate with developers and stakeholders to enhance infrastructure reliability and scalability
- Automate infrastructure provisioning, configuration, and monitoring processes
- Optimize system performance and ensure high availability of services
- Maintain comprehensive system documentation and operational standards
- Implement best practices for continuous integration and continuous delivery workflows
Requirements:
- Strong experience in DevOps or related engineering roles
- Expertise in Docker, Kubernetes, and cloud platforms such as AWS
- Proficiency with automation tools including Terraform and GitHub Actions
- Strong understanding of CI/CD pipeline design and implementation
- Excellent written and verbal communication skills
- Ability to work independently in a fast-paced, remote environment
- Strong problem-solving and analytical skills